Role: Senior Legal Administrator

Location: Glasgow

Employment Type: Full-time, permanent

Salary: £30,000

Are you an experienced legal administrator or legal secretary looking for a senior-level role?

Do you enjoy supporting senior stakeholders and working in a fast-paced professional environment?

Are you looking to join a business where your organisation and attention to detail make a real impact?

We are working with Just Employment Law to recruit a Senior Legal Administrator to join their Glasgow head office. This is an excellent opportunity to become part of a professional and supportive team, providing high-level administrative support across legal, business development, and leadership functions.

You will play a key role in supporting fee earners and senior stakeholders, ensuring the smooth day-to-day running of administrative processes and contributing to the overall efficiency of the business.

The Role

The successful candidate will provide senior administrative and executive support across a range of business areas, working closely with legal teams and senior leadership.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Formatting and proofreading legal documents and correspondence
  • Managing diaries and coordinating meetings
  • Supporting Employment Tribunal processes, including preparing documentation and maintaining files
  • Handling client correspondence and communications with third parties
  • Audio typing using digital dictation
  • Supporting onboarding and maintenance of client accounts
  • Assisting with business development activity, including proposals and client communications
  • Supporting marketing initiatives and client engagement activity
  • Providing executive support to senior leadership, including travel arrangements and scheduling
  • Supporting office operations, including reception cover and facilities coordination

Essential Skills & Experience

  • Previous experience in a legal administrative or legal secretarial role
  •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office and CRM systems
  • Audio typing experience with good speed and accuracy
  • Excellent organisational and time management skills
  • Strong communication skills and a professional approach

The ideal candidate will also

  • Be proactive, organised, and able to work on their own initiative
  • Thrive in a fast-paced environment
  • Take pride in delivering high-quality, accurate work
  • Be a team player who supports colleagues across the business
  • Have a positive and flexible approach to work

What’s on Offer

  • A salary of £30,000 Per annum
  • Pension and life assurance
  • Healthcare provision
  • Enhanced annual leave (37 days)
